Handover note for the office manager: the batch of six calibration weights (Class F1, 1 g through 500 g) came back from Tarnoway Metrology on Tuesday with fresh certificates. I've logged them in the asset register and stored the case in the instrument cupboard, top shelf. The 200 g weight shows a minor nick — Tarnoway says it's still within tolerance, but flag it at the next audit. Pell Express will collect the old retired set Thursday, and their driver should follow the instruction stated below.

drop instructions, bagug-kagup: the rusath julmir courier leaves the ralwyn aldok eliius ledger at gate 8603 under passcode 993062

Subject: On-call intro — cold storage archiving

Welcome aboard. Your main recurring task is the weekly archive sweep for Frostvault cold storage buckets. Buckets untouched for 90 days get flagged; confirm the retention tag before approving any move, since legal holds override the policy. Mistakes here are expensive to reverse, so follow the checklist exactly. The step-by-step procedure is on this page:

operations page: https://confluence.qorvellabs.internal/projects/projects/projects/pages/a358

Subject: Transcode farm cut-over complete

Team — the Velgrip transcode farm moved to the new Orvane cluster last night. Old workers drained by 02:00, queue replayed clean, no dropped jobs. Legacy nodes stay powered for one week, then get wiped. Dashboards repointed; alerts rerouted to the Orvane channel. If a job stalls, check codec pool saturation first. The active settings for the new farm are listed below.

config for tahaf-yafog:
[aldax]
team = pelok
access_code = ac_56c493
host = aldax.sivrelforge.corp
port = 8443
owner = ulair.gorius
peer = norius.ferrahq.internal

# Watchdog fixture for the Brightpole kiosk app.
# The watchdog pings the Lumenrack heartbeat endpoint every 20s;
# three missed pings trigger a forced relaunch. This fixture fakes
# two misses, then a recovery, so the relaunch path never fires.
# Don't shorten the intervals — the debounce logic rounds to 5s
# and the test goes flaky. New folks: run against staging only.
# The fixture authenticates with the bearer token below.

login token, bagug-kafop: eyJhbGciOiJIUzI1NiIsInR5cCI6IkpXVCJ9.eyJzdWIiOiIcMLov2In0.Z5RLDIfp